And past in class stuff included:
5. To calculate the number of grains of rice for each square of the king's chessboard, you could use the equation NEXT = NOW x 2, beginning at 2 grains for the first square. So the number of grains of rice for square 2 could be represented as 2 x 2.
a. Why can the number of grains of rice for square 3 be expressed as (2 x 2) x 2? b. Write expressions for the number of grains of rice for squares 5, 10, and 20. c. What is the shorthand way of writing the calculations in Part b using exponents? d. Write an exponential expression for the number of grains of rice for square 64. For any square x. e. Compare your exponential expressions in Parts c and d with those of another group. Resolve any differences.
